What is the sum of the first 50 terms in the arithmetic sequence 5, 8, 11, 14,...?

Answer:

3925

Step-by-step explanation:

We can use the formula  [tex]an=a1+(n-1)d[/tex]  to find 50th term where:

[tex]an[/tex] is the nth term in the sequence

[tex]a1[/tex] is the first term in the sequence

[tex]d[/tex] is common difference between terms

[tex]5+(50-1)*3=152[/tex]

We also use the formula [tex]Sn=n*(a1+an/2)[/tex] to find the sum

[tex]50*(\frac{5+152}{2})=3925[/tex]
